Geodetic

Geodetic is a standalone applicartion which will allow the user to carry out a series of geodetic calculations using either predefined parameters or user input data. The software was first developed in 1984 to run on a PC running under DOS and has been constantly been redeveloped in line with PC development. The current version runs under Windows XP and Vista.

Datum Shift

 

Methods Include

  • 3 / 5 / 7 Parameter Shift
  • NADCON (North American Datum)
  • Statens KartVerk Norway.
  • Geographical Shifts
  • Grid Translations
  • OSGB

    Spheroids

     

    35 pre-defined spheroids including:-
    •           GRS80
    •          WGS84
    •          Hayford International.
    •          Clarke
    •          Bessel
    •          Everest

    Plus user entered data of:-

     

    • Semi-Major Axis (a)
    • Semi-Minor Axis (b)
    • Inverse Flattening (f)
    • Eccentricity (e)

     
     


    Projections

     

    Projections types include:-

    • Transverse Mercator
    • Mercator
    • Lambert Conical
    • Cassini-Soldner
    • Azimuthal Equidistant
    • State Plane (USA)
    • Rectified Skew Orthomorphic (Borneo and Malaysia),
    • Norwegian National Grid (NGO)
    • Danish National Grid
    • Stereographic.  
     

     Including over 150 pre-defined projection parameters.


     

     Datums

     

    Predefined datum shift parameters including:-

    •  WGS84 to OSGB36
    • NADCON (North American Datum)
    •  Statens KartVerk Norway.

    Plus user entered data of:-

    • Transformations (dX, dY, dZ)
    • Rotations (rX, rY, rZ)
    • Scale Factor (ppm)

     Rotation Method

    • Co-ordinate Frame
    • Position Vector
